Transaction 68b3076641ab2edb322b32c2f6b5b5508a3d170906451d827c32e38f06e7f40d

1 Input
2 Outputs
  • 68b3076641ab2edb322b32c2f6b5b5508a3d170906451d827c32e38f06e7f40d:0
  • value  2935178
    address  12SujRTbnTqUPBDXwo6LzERMcHDEDGJRtg
  • 68b3076641ab2edb322b32c2f6b5b5508a3d170906451d827c32e38f06e7f40d:1
  • value  273946
    address  bc1qk5eg64mv94lcvetx0ed3xkh0g3tp0kvkagr205